Sunshine on Glasgow

A flying visit to Glasgow this week as MyWeddingSketcher

A midweek wedding at the Royal College of Physicians & Surgeons of Glasgow on St Vincent Street. What a stunning building, and really pretty part of the city, just up the hill and away from the busy shops.

The wedding party had photos taken in Blythswood Square and below is a sketch of the college. Great architecture and such a mixture of buildings in Edinburgh that I love the random beauty, I must go back soon.

Before I left I made a quick sketch from the Buchanan Galleries as the sun came down on the famous shopping high street.

All thoughts are in Glasgow

GlasgowSaltireSt Andrews Day today, but Saltires across the country will be flying at half mast as a mark of respect for those affected by the helicopter crash in Glasgow.

 

Like so many I have been unable to think of much else in the last 24 hours as the news has been getting progressively worse throughout the day. At the most recent statement, eight lives were lost when a police helicopter crashed onto the roof of the Clutha Pub in Glasgow’s city centre.

My thoughts are with the families and friends of those involved. God bless everyone.
